Descrição da oferta de emprego

Do you want to work in one of the fastest growing and most innovative businesses at Amazon? Amazon Devices is looking for a Supply Chain Manager for its portfolio of devices and accessories.

This role sits within the BR Devices team and is the subject matter expert for supply planning, inventory allocation, order management and vendor support, for a category of current and upcoming Devices, and is responsible to deliver process improvements, automation and customer experience improvements, within the team’s project roadmap.

The Supply Chain Manager is responsible for developing and executing best practices in managing inventory, supply chain and operations to maximize customer experience, sales, in-stock rates and inventory turns. This individual has responsibility for ensuring all inventory systems and processes are meeting the needs of the business and implementing controls around these processes. She/He also owns driving improvement in inventory availability and efficiency, purchasing efficiency and costs reduction across the Devices business, solving in a scalable way that will support growth as well as our long-term business strategy.

A successful candidate possesses business judgment, in-stock, supply chain and/or operations management experience, strong skills in working collaboratively and cross functionally, analytical capabilities, including experience handling large and complex data sets.

The position requires an individual who can work both autonomously and collaboratively in a demanding and often ambiguous environment with attention to details and effective prioritization.

Key job responsibilities

  1. Manage our end-to-end planning processes and workflows across the devices network for Amazon Devices
  2. Manage end-to-end importation and distribution processes through Amazon's supply chain
  3. Create and implement inventory allocation strategies to optimize inventory placement, sales, turns, and customer experience
  4. Partner regularly with a broad set of stakeholders including WW planning, sales, finance, marketing and other teams
  5. Own and communicate demand insights and supply allocation plans to key cross-functional internal stakeholders
  6. Facilitate data-driven decision-making with sales and marketing leaders
  7. Invent and simplify processes to ensure we are constantly improving operations for our internal and external customers

About the team
The BR Devices Supply team aims to ensure that Amazon devices and accessories arrive to the right location, at the right time and in the right quantities to be available to our end customers. Doing this well allows our internal customers to take the right actions to drive their business goals. The team collaborates closely with stakeholders, advising on business questions and sharing clear and well-structured insights to help drive informed decision-making.
